About the Book
In 1021 AD, most of Europe and some of its neighboring territories was secretly under the dominion of a supernatural cabal that calls itself the Council. A man who shouldn't matter at all threatens to disrupt their rule, and they've dispatched a Hunting party composed of three ancient and powerful Ascended to chase him across the Iberian Peninsula and catch him.
They have everything they need. Aurelian of Arles is a powerful and renowned Hunter. Their Seeker, Eirleida, can find a discarded pin on the other side of the world. And a Maker known as Leontios of Miletus carries with him wonders that sometimes make the other two's heads spin. They are chasing a man so weak he was barely able to Ascend at all. It should have been an easy hunt.
Yet nothing ever seems to go the way it should. Whenever they think they've pinned down the renegade, he slips through their grasp. When they think they have the advantage, they find he has turned the tables on them. Neither superior strength nor the backing of an organization that makes kings kneel seems to have any effect on their quarry.
Everything they know about the world—and about Hunting in particular—is being turned on its head by this one man who should have turned around and surrendered as soon as he found out they were after him. As the narrow escapes, traps, and manipulations stack up, the team begins to realize that what they thought were failures on their part were really the successes of plans carefully laid by the very man they are supposed to catch.
As the Hunt leads the party out of Iberia, out of Europe, it also takes them further from Council support and authority. Soon, they find themselves on their own, and with no idea how to stop their quarry before he finds whatever it is he seeks.

About the Author
Max Guernsey is a software developer, nonfiction author, and novelist. His fiction blends engineering, mythology, ancient catastrophe theories, religious and philosophical questions, and a practical interest in how people, tools, institutions, and technologies actually worked in the eras he writes about.
